SUMMARY:Melbourne International Coffee Expo (MICE2017)
DESCRIPTION:The Melbourne International Coffee Expo (MICE) is Australasia’s largest and most exciting coffee-dedicated event. \nMICE is the place for lovers of the bean to let the five senses come to life and taste coffees\, teas and treats from all over the world. \nWhat’s on… \nAustralian Coffee Championships \nWith all the Coffee Championships back at MICE\, watch the country’s best baristas battle-it-out in the Australian Barista Championship\, PURA Australian Latte Art Championship\, Australian Brewers Cup\, Australian Cup Tasters Championship and the Australian Coffee in Good Spirits Championship. \nBrewing Lounge \nNew for 2017\, The Brewing Lounge is where you are able to taste the coffees made by competitors in the Australian Brewers Cup. \nSensory Lab Brew Bar \nMeet the Sensory Lab crew as they demonstrate the latest coffee trends and gadgets. \nRoasters Alley \nSample the best brews from local and international roasters. \nOrigin Alley \nMeet the growers behind your favourite cup of coffee and explore the origin of the famous bean. \nProduct Innovation Awards \nExhibitors will be submitting their newest and most innovative products for you to decide The People’s Choice Award. \nFood Village \nUnwind in the outdoor food village and enjoy a range of dishes from local food trucks. \nAustralian International Coffee Awards and MICE Launch Party \nCelebrate coffee roasting excellence with the RASV Australian International Coffee Awards and official MICE2017 Launch Party. \nTea Expo \nWe didn’t forget about the tea lovers. For the first time in 2017 MICE will be partnering with the Australian International Tea Expo\, where you can find anything and everything tea related. \n***Early bird tickets on sale until 31 Decemeber 2016***

SUMMARY:Thai Songkran New Year 2017
DESCRIPTION:Saturday 1 April: Thai Food Stalls\nSunday 2 April: Opening Ceremony\, Thai Entertainment and Food Stalls. \nThai Songkran New Year celebration is rich with symbolic traditions. Performing water pouring on Buddha statues is considered an iconic ritual for this holiday. It represents purification and the washing away of one’s sins and brings good luck to everyone. \nCelebrants\, young and old\, participate in this tradition by splashing water on each other. Traditional fashion parades are also held. \nThe event will showcase the Thai culture\, food and all things Thai.\nWe look forward to share this event to the Australian people. \nEntertainment Programs for 2 April\n– Water pouring on Buddha Statues\n– Thai Drummer Dance\n– Thai Traditional Dances\n– Thai Kick Boxing Show (Muay Thai)\n– Thai Cooking Shows\n– Thai Traditional Costume & Silk Fashion Show\n– Thai Traditional Massage Show – sharing knowledge of the benefits of Thai Massage\n– Thai Food Stalls\n– Songkran New Year Water Splash for blessing at the end of the program (3.30pm) \nThis event is organized by ASEAN Association and is apart of the month of South East Asia.
